Measuring an inch is relatively simple using a ruler or measuring tape, both of which have markings denoting inches and fractions of an inch. Each inch is further divided into smaller units called fractions or increments. Common fraction denominators you may come across when measuring an inch include halves (½), quarters (¼), eighths (⅛), and sixteenths (1/16). These fractional divisions allow for precise measurements when dealing with small-scale objects or constructions.
For example, imagine you are measuring a wooden board. If the length of the board is 36 inches, you can measure it accurately by breaking it down into smaller parts using fractions. Each inch is divided into two halves, four quarters, eight eighths, or sixteen sixteenths. So, if you need to cut the board precisely in half, you will measure 18 inches, or if you need it in quarters, 9 inches would be the appropriate measurement. This breakdown makes measuring more precise and avoids any unnecessary errors.
